Roberta Buiani, Artist and Lecturer

Roberta Buiani is a community artist, program advisor at Subtle Technologies Festival, and lecturer in Science and Technology Studies and Science Fiction Studies at York University (CAN).


She received a PhD in Communication and Cultural Studies from York University and completed a postdoctoral fellowship at the Canada Research Chair in Technoscience at Lakehead University. Her work at the intersection between science, technology and the arts, questions their traditional role and looks for threads that facilitate cross-communication between disciplines, individuals and creativity. Her viral interventions (”The Viral-Knitting Project,” “Megaphone Choir,” “YorkisUs”) and experimental labs (the sandbox project) investigate the role of the “viral” as concept and creative practice that carries potentials to transform social customs and the way we communicate.
